The Warhammer X JOYTOY partnership produces another Primarch. Magnus The Red comes from the Horus Heresy!

Well, I think it’s safe to say they’ve done it again. Magnus The Red joins the ranks of Dorn, Russ, Horus and Abaddon as an epic action figure from JOYTOY. Behold the Primarch of the Thousand Sons in all his magical glory.

about the Warhammer community

“He is Magnus the Red, standing 10.25″ tall to the tip of his horns (that’s taller than even Horus) and brimming with mysterious magnificence. Every detail of his phenomenal resin miniature has been faithfully recreated, right down to the swirling magical effects that can shoot from his hands or wrap around his enormous Blade of Ahn-nunurta.”

Magnus the Red – JOYTOY Action Figure

This figure is really impressive as it is a faithful recreation of the resin miniature but as an action figure. They even copied the magical effects that shoot out of his hands. Seriously, look at these details:

For comparison, check out the resin miniature from Forge World:

The paintwork is different, but the action figure looks real close. I wouldn’t be surprised if you could recreate this pose with the resin action figure.

More Thousand Sons

Magnus The Red isn’t the only Thousand Son from the Horus Heresy era to come from JOYTOY, though. There’s a trio of helpful “friends” who accompany their Primarch.

Magistus Amon

“Magistus Amon served as his Primarch’s equerry throughout the Great Crusade, and rumor has it that he was even the young Magnus’s tutor before his reunion with the Emperor. Yet despite his great fame, he remained a mysterious and lonely figure.”

I like the details here too. The paint job isn’t as elaborate as miniature paint jobs can be, but it’s not bad! I also particularly like the details on the cape.

Azhek Ahriman

You know, it just wouldn’t feel like a proper Horus Heresy release for the Thousand Sons without Ahriman there to accompany his Primarch, so I’m glad JOYTOY got to do this one too. And again, this one looks like it has a lot of the same details as the miniature.

Praetor of the XV Legion

And finally, we get a “generic” XVth Legion Praetor. While this could just be a faceless Praetor, I still want to give my appreciation to this Terminator with all the bling he wears. He still has the Achaean Power Weapon that the Horus Heresy era Thousand Sons were also known for.
